DK thanks PM for cancelling Lankan trip

Chennai, Jan 7 (UNI) Dravidar Kazhagam (DK) President K Veeramani today thanked Prime Minister Manmohan Singh on behalf of the Tamils for cancelling his proposed visit to Sri Lanka to take part in the latter's Independence Day celebrations on February 4.

In a statement here, he said the decision deserved to be hailed as the Prime Minister's visit at a time when the island nation's Government had launched an offensive against the Tamils would send a wrong signal.

Mr Veeramani, along with Viduthalai Chiruthaigal Katchi (VCK) President Thol Thirumavalavan, both staunch supporters of Eelam Tamils, had staged a joint demonstration here on December 31 last year, against the Prime Minister's proposed visit.

They had appealed to the Centre that neither the Prime Minister nor anyone on behalf of India should visit the island nation and attend its Independence Day celebrations.

Any such participation would only strengthen the hands of the Sri Lankan Government, which had launched an offensive against the Tamils, and spellED doom for them, the two leaders said.
